PEM Water Electrolyzer Market Insights

The proton exchange membrane (PEM) water electrolyzer market is witnessing rapid growth, driven by factors such as increasing demand for high-efficiency electrolysis systems, advancements in PEM technology, and the growing emphasis on green hydrogen production. PEM electrolyzers offer several advantages over traditional alkaline electrolyzers, including higher efficiency, compact size, and rapid response times, making them ideal for various applications such as renewable energy storage, power-to-gas, and fuel cell vehicles. According to MRFR analysis,PEM Water Electrolyzer Market Size was valued at USD 9,352.3 million in 2023. The PEM Water Electrolyzer Market industry is projected to grow from USD 9,950.9 million in 2024 to USD 16,345.3 million by 2032,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.4% during the forecast period (2024 - 2032)

Unveiling the Potential of Water Electrolysis: A Market Overview

Water electrolysis, the process of splitting water molecules into hydrogen and oxygen using electricity, has emerged as a promising technology with vast implications for the energy sector and beyond. As the world transitions towards sustainable energy sources and decarbonization, the PEM Water Electrolyzer Market holds significant potential in unlocking clean hydrogen production and addressing global energy challenges.

One of the primary drivers behind the growth of the PEM Water Electrolyzer Market is the increasing emphasis on renewable energy integration. Renewable sources such as wind and solar energy often face intermittency challenges, with generation patterns not always aligning with demand. Electrolysis offers a solution by converting excess renewable energy into hydrogen, which can be stored and utilized when needed, effectively balancing the grid and maximizing renewable energy utilization.
